EDI to help in revitalising Gujarat textile clusters

After lending a helping hand to the Jamnagar brass-parts and components cluster and Rajkot's engineering cluster, the Entrepreneurship Development Institute of India (EDI), Ahmedabad, is now out to assist the revival of Vadodara's engineering cluster and also textile machinery clusters at Ahmedabad, Surat and Surendranagar.

As EDI's efforts to revitalise the brass-parts and components cluster at Jamnagar in Gujarat is , accomplished, it is now engaged in enforcing the revitalization plans for engineering cluster in Vadodara and the textile machinery clusters at Ahmedabad, Surat and Surendranagar.

Mr Yogesh Agrawal, President, EDI and Chairman, IDBI Bank Ltd., while speaking at the institute's 11th Convocation of the 'Post-Graduate Diploma in Management - Business Entrepreneurship' (PGDMBE) and 'Post-Graduate Diploma in Management of NGOs', said that the institute has marked its success in strategizing the handicraft and handloom clusters across the country.

Mr Vijay Mallya, Chairman, UB Group, who was present at the function in his capacity as Chief Guest, said that, as we take a look at some of the India's leading companies like Reliance and Airtel and will discover that, it is the entrepreneur spirit which works behind their success.

Also, he while citing the example of Microsoft quoted that, it was this spirit of entrepreneurship that made it successful, a company that was founded by college dropouts.
